Abstract :
This paper presents a new fast response digital PID control circuit for dc-dc converter, its dynamic characteristics and the design criterion. In the conventional digital PID control method, the sampling rate is single and the calculation process of P-I-D control is series. On the other hand, in the proposed method, the sampling rate is divided each sampling period. The calculation process of P and I-D controls is parallel. The sampling interval and points for I-D control are same to the conventional method. However, the sampling point of P control is oversampling during the switching period of the converter. The simulation and experiment results of the output voltage against the step change of the load are discussed. As a result, it is revealed experimentally that the fast transient response is obtained. The convergence time of output voltage of proposed method is less than 1/3 of that of conventional one when the output smoothing capacitance becomes small.
